The International Logistics market is a complex and ever-evolving sector of the logistics industry. It involves the coordination of resources and services to move goods from one location to another, often across international borders. This includes the management of freight, customs clearance, warehousing, and other related services. It also involves the use of technology to ensure efficient and cost-effective transportation of goods.
The International Logistics market is highly competitive, with many companies offering a variety of services. These companies range from large multinationals to smaller, specialized providers. They are often specialized in specific areas such as air freight, ocean freight, customs clearance, and warehousing.
